How many wines ought to I embody in a tasting menu?undefinedA good rule of thumb is to incorporate 3 to six wines in your tasting menu. This allows visitors to completely respect each wine without feeling overwhelmed. If food pairings are included, ensure that the variety of wines corresponds to the programs being served.


What kinds of wines should I feature for different occasions?undefinedFor celebratory events like weddings, contemplate glowing wines or high-quality whites. For autumn gatherings, wealthy reds can complement seasonal dishes. Tailor your choices to match the occasion, the season, and the preferences of your guests.

How can I accommodate guests with differing wine preferences?undefinedTo cater to a diverse group, embrace a combination of pink, white, and rosé wines. You might also consider incorporating a dessert wine or a non-alcoholic option. Providing tasting notes might help guide visitors in their choices, making certain everybody finds one thing they get pleasure from.


What food pairings ought to I embody with the wine tasting?undefinedPair meals that improve the wines chosen, similar to light cheeses with whites, charcuterie with reds, or fruit with dessert wines. Guarantee the flavors complement one another; think about arranging food and wine in a method that displays seasonal components or the theme of the occasion.
